To set up the MFA, Google has an open source tool called Google Authenticator, which is widely covered on all the platforms for Multi-Factor Authentication (MFA) or Two-Factor Authentication (TFA). Along with user username and password, users should enter the dynamically generated MFA code to login into cloud instances. Multi-Factor Authentication (MFA) is the solution we are looking for. In fact, you can easily get your Bastion host compromised by hackers and they would get access to all the machines behind this “firewall”. In this way you can easily add a hop in your connection process: only Bastion Hosts have access to your cloud instances inside AWS.Įven if a Bastion Host could be the first solution, this is not we are looking for when we are dealing with security in the cloud. In this case, you will open the 22 port to the public on the Bastion host Security Group and for the rest of the machines, you can open the 22 port only for the Bastion host Security Group. Usually, DevOps and sysadmins create a Bastion host in order to access any other cloud instance from the Public Internet. But is this a safe way to connect to your servers? NO, not really. If you deploy your instances either in EC2-Classic or EC2-VPC public subnet, you can reach the machines easily by opening the 22 port to the public. Being able to easily access your cloud instances from the Public Internet is one of the most requested features from developers and system administrators.
